<p>Your voice matters! Using storytelling, the Constitution, and a practical DEMOCRACY TOOLKIT, this nonpartisan guide brings civics to life -- because every kid has a role in shaping America's future. Motivating young changemakers to participate in America's democratic process, this curriculum-aligned handbook for civic engagement applies real-world examples to explain the Constitution and Bill of Rights, the history of voting, why protests matter, and how to spot disinformation. Ruby Bridges stood up to segregation. Parkland students demanded safer schools. Greta Thunberg mobilized millions around environmental concerns. Democracy Starts With Us encourages elementary and middle school students to take action now rather than sit back and wait their turn to change the world. Written for ages 7-12 and the adults around them -- parents, teachers, librarians, educators, and community leaders. Includes a "Democracy Toolkit," glossary, and discussion questions. Essential for social studies curriculum and homeschool civics lessons. While acknowledging democracy's serious challenges, it leaves readers hopeful about what informed, engaged young people can accomplish.</p>
